Fixed Interval

A schedule of reinforcement where the first response is rewarded only after a specified amount of time has elapsed, leading to a pattern of responses.

Variable Interval

Variable interval refers to a type of reinforcement schedule in operant conditioning where a response is rewarded after an unpredictable amount of time has passed, leading to a steady and resistant response rate.

Variable Ratio

A schedule of reinforcement where a response is reinforced after an unpredictable number of responses, making it highly resistant to extinction.
